On 07/13/2016 12:53 PM, Crestez Dan Leonard wrote:
> When using devicetree stuff like i2c_client.name or spi_device.modalias
> is initialized to the first DT compatible id with the vendor prefix
> stripped. Since some drivers rely on this in order to differentiate between
> hardware variants try to replicate it when using ACPI with DT ids.
>
> This also makes it so that the i2c_device_id parameter passed to probe is
> non-NULL when matching with ACPI and DT ids.

> These patches are on top of linux-pm/linux-next. I delayed v2 until ACPI
> overlays got in in order to avoid conflicts. I tested using ACPI overlays but
> there is no actual dependency. This series just extends the PRP0001 feature to
> be more useful for I2C/SPI.
>
> The patches only touches the ACPI-specific parts of the i2c and spi core.
>
> Here is an example .dsl for an SPI accelerometer connected to minnowboard max:
>
> Device (ACCL)
> {
>     Name (_ADR, Zero)
>     Name (_HID, "PRP0001")
>     Name (_CID, "PRP0001")
>     Name (_UID, One)
>
>     Method (_CRS, 0, Serialized)
>     {
>       Name (RBUF, ResourceTemplate ()
>       {
>           SPISerialBus(1, PolarityLow, FourWireMode, 16,
>                   ControllerInitiated, 1000000, ClockPolarityLow,
>                   ClockPhaseFirst, "\\_SB.SPI1",)
>           GpioInt (Edge, ActiveHigh, Exclusive, PullDown, 0x0000,
>                    "\\_SB.GPO2", 0x00, ResourceConsumer, , )
>           { // Pin list
>                   1
>           }
>       })
>       Return (RBUF)
>     }
>     Name (_DSD, Package ()
>     {
>       ToUUID("daffd814-6eba-4d8c-8a91-bc9bbf4aa301"),
>       Package ()
>       {
>           Package () {"compatible", "st,lis3dh"},
>       }
>     })
> }
